City Council to “Preview” New General Plan on July 20

The Albany City Council will receive a briefing on the 2035 General Plan at their regular meeting on July 20, 2015. Members of the public are encouraged to attend and may comment on the item. The Council will receive a short presentation on the status of the project and the schedule for its completion.   The presentation will include highlights from seven chapters—or “elements”—of the Plan, including Land Use, Transportation, Conservation and Sustainability, Parks and Open Space, Environmental Hazards, Community Services and Facilities, and Waterfront. A staff report, including the 100-page “Compendium of Policies” will be posted to this website prior to the meeting time.  The meeting will take place in the Albany City Hall Council Chambers at 1000 San Pablo Avenue at 7:00 PM.
